Meaning & Origin of Tamsyn

What this name means, where it came from, and how it has traveled across cultures.

Thomasina, Thomasine, or Thomasena is the feminine form of the given name Thomas, which means "twin". Thomasina is often shortened to Tamsin. Tamsin can be used as a name in itself; variants of Tamsin include Tamsyn, Tamzin, Tamsen, Tamzen, Tammi, Tamzie and Tamasin. The version "Tamsin" is especially popular in Cornwall and Wales. Along with Tamara it is the ancestor of "Tammy".

The Story of Tamsyn

Tamsyn first appeared in U.S. Social Security Administration records as a baby girl name in 1976, with 11 babies given the name that year. Its peak popularity came in 2016, when 15 Tamsyns were born — ranking #7,601 that year. As of 2026, Tamsyn ranks #15,243 for baby girls with 5 births, falling sharply (-44%). In total, more than 180 Tamsyns have been born in the U.S. since records began in 1880, spanning the 1970s through the 2020s.
